Thane is a large terrestrial planet in the star system of the same name, named after a city on Earth. It is governed by the Commonwealth of Thane, a member state of the Allied Worlds. The Commonwealth is a federal republic.

Physical Planetography

The planet is higher-gravity than Earth, and was at the time of its discovery extremely hot and arid, with liquid water existing only at the poles. (Though the planet had some water vapor and water bound in minerals.) Imperial terraformers seeded the planet with genetically engineered photosynthetic organisms to convert carbon dioxide into oxygen, and dumped millions of tonnes of lightweight, white-colored expanded glasses made from asteroidal materials onto it, raising its albedo. These actions lowered surface temperatures sufficiently to allow the liquid water zone to expand progressively farther from the poles, leading to further proliferation of the photosynthetic organisms and further global cooling as water vapor condensed and removed itself from the atmosphere. (To this day, great rafts of expanded glasses float on the oceans of Thane - pretty much everywhere there is not a mat of oxygen-producing algae - and they are a major constituent of its beaches.) As it is now, the average surface temperature is 39C, still very hot, with temperatures in excess of 100C still common in equatorial regions. Life is concentrated at non-tropical latitudes. Genetic enhancements allowing the inhabitants to tolerate higher temperatures are very common. The planet has a 56 hour day, and is very windy. The atmosphere is moderately thicker than Earth's, with an atmospheric pressure of about 2 bar at the surface. The air is breathable, though only at low altitudes (where colonization is naturally focused.) Oxygen supplementation - usually portable concentrators based on molecular sieves - is used at higher altitudes.

Thane is comparatively poor in surface metals.

Culture and History

Thane was colonized mainly by Muslims who rejected M. bin Zayed of Taumenst's claim to be the Mahdi, and who were accordingly expelled from Taumenst. They joined a earlier colony on Thane which was struggling at the time, and succeeded in turning things around. By the time M. bin Zayed's rebellion was put down by the Empire, the colony was prospering and most of the exiles had put down roots on Thane, deciding not to return to Taumenst.

Most inhabitants today are Muslim (60%, mostly followers of the Grand Fiqh) or secular/non-religious (32%). There are substantial minorities of other faiths. Rimward Arabic is widespread as a liturgical language, and the local dialect of Standard Imperial has definite phonetic and lexical influences.

Thane is quite populous, with almost eight billion human inhabitants. The oceans are too hot for Biran, even near the poles. Thane has no ice cap and relatively little seasonal variation. Its oceans are discontinuous, "sea level" is quite low on Thane.

Economy

Thane has a highly developed economy and is self-sufficient. Colonists from Thane live on several other worlds in its system, and there is well-developed space infrastructure including propellant mining. Thane has a robust biotechnology sector and many notable universities.

The Allied Words Space Force has a training facility for the Spaceborne Infantry on Thane. The combination of a breathable atmosphere and harsh conditions is identified by the Infantry Training Command as providing an environment which is "very rigorous, but forgiving of mistakes, making it especially suitable for training purposes." "Forgiving" is obviously relative.
